7.3 Setting of alarm clock
Press and hold ALARM button.
A brief beep tone will sound.
flashes on the LCD of the display.
The hour digit is flashing. Press UP or DOWN button to adjust the hours.
Press ALARM button again and you can adjust the minutes with the UP or DOWN
button.
Confirm with ALARM button.
The display shows the current time.
Press ALARM button again and the alarm function is activated.
appears on the display.
Once the alarm starts to ring (3 different sounds), you can stop the alarm by
pressing any button.
You can activate the snooze function by pressing the SNOOZE/BRIGHTNESS but-
ton on the top.
flashes and the alarm will be interrupted for 4 minutes.
To turn off the alarm function, press again the ALARM button.
7.4 Backlight
To activate the brightness of the backlight (2 levels), press SNOOZE/BRIGHTNESS
button.
8. Care and maintenance
Clean it with a soft damp cloth. Do not use solvents or scouring agents. Protect
from moisture.
Remove the batteries if you do not use the product for a lengthy period.
Keep the instrument in a dry place.
7. Operation
Important: Buttons will not function while scanning DCF signal.
During the operation, all successful settings will be confirmed by a brief beep
tone.
The instrument will automatically quit the setting mode if no button is pressed
within 20 seconds.
Press and hold UP or DOWN button in the setting mode for fast running.
7.1 Manual setting of clock, time zone and calendar
Press and hold SET button in normal mode. A brief beep tone will sound. 00 is
flashing. Press UP or DOWN buttons the time zone (+12/-12).
The time zone setting is needed for countries where the DCF signal can be
received but the time zone is different from the German time.
Press SET button to make the settings in the following sequence: Hours, minutes,
year, month and day. Press UP or DOWN button to adjust it.
Confirm with SET button.
The manually set time will be overwritten by the DCF time when the signal is
received successfully
Press SET button to change between time and date (DATE appears on the dis-
play).
7.2 12 and 24 hours system indication
Press DOWN button in normal mode to choose 12 HR or 24 HR system.
A brief beep tone will sound.
In 12 HR system AM or PM appears on the display.
